Chapter 8. Ports and Harbors that Support the "Age of Global Exchanges"


Section 1. Present Situations Surrounding Ports and Harbors and Future Policies


@ @ Japan has entered the "age of global exchanges". Personal exchanges beyond borders are common. Goods and information are being exchanged among nations, regions and individuals. The roles that ports and harbors are expected to play are now diversified and sophisticated. Under such circumstances, the Ministry formulated long-term policies for ports and harbors titled "Ports m the Age of Global Exchanges"' in June 1995. Based on the policies, the Ministry revised "Basic Directions on Port Development". It plans to carry out port administration based on the 9th Five-year Port Development Plan (FY1996-2000).
